Transaction b81a4fa93914d87c00c0a57c3f9d312df6611f323933ceb372453bea9ffd3fb6

23 Input
1 Outputs
  • b81a4fa93914d87c00c0a57c3f9d312df6611f323933ceb372453bea9ffd3fb6:0
  • value  22247277403
    address  12h2Usa4F2EsLfFdajkfVLHsH8gF8KqkFe